Transaction 9575f3db36b767e160ca08bfc558817275140e9eda2e306aa6d538dea76e2e3e

1 Input
2 Outputs
  • 9575f3db36b767e160ca08bfc558817275140e9eda2e306aa6d538dea76e2e3e:0
  • value  150327965
    address  3JmqqzuV5MqZnfsu1aEqwNmGudDUxtrTPb
  • 9575f3db36b767e160ca08bfc558817275140e9eda2e306aa6d538dea76e2e3e:1
  • value  150756535
    address  33J7puQEaymt6DyvWgeQ1KcKmfXfMJAVnC